In 2010, KFC introduced the Double Down Sandwich, and sold 10 million of them in the first month. Now the cult favorite is back, and folks are stoked.
If you’re unfamiliar with the sandwich, it’s a monster. It features two of KFC’s Extra Crispy white meat filets, two slices of cheese, two pieces of hickory-smoked bacon, and mayo or the Colonel’s spicy sauce. No bun in this sandwich.
According to MSN, the sandwich will be available beginning March 6 nationwide. But it will only stay on the KFC menus for a limited time. The huge sandwich will only have a four-week run.
